package types
import (
"math/big"
"testing"
"github.com/stretchr/testify/require"
ethcmn "github.com/ethereum/go-ethereum/common"
)
func TestValidateGenesisAccount(t *testing.T) {
testCases := []struct {
name string
genesisAccount GenesisAccount
expPass bool
}{
{
"valid genesis account",
GenesisAccount{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{1, 2, 3},
Storage: []GenesisStorage{
NewGenesisStorage(ethcmn.BytesToHash([]byte{1, 2, 3}), ethcmn.BytesToHash([]byte{1, 2, 3})),
},
},
true,
},
{
"empty account address bytes",
GenesisAccount{
Address: ethcmn.Address{},
Balance: big.NewInt(1),
},
false,
},
{
"nil account balance",
GenesisAccount{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: nil,
},
false,
},
{
"nil account balance",
GenesisAccount{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(-1),
},
false,
},
{
"empty code bytes",
GenesisAccount{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{},
},
false,
},
{
"empty storage key bytes",
GenesisAccount{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{1, 2, 3},
Storage: []GenesisStorage{
{Key: ethcmn.Hash{}},
},
},
false,
},
{
"duplicated storage key",
GenesisAccount{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{1, 2, 3},
Storage: []GenesisStorage{
{Key: ethcmn.BytesToHash([]byte{1, 2, 3})},
{Key: ethcmn.BytesToHash([]byte{1, 2, 3})},
},
},
false,
},
}
for _, tc := range testCases {
tc := tc
err := tc.genesisAccount.Validate()
if tc.expPass {
require.NoError(t, err, tc.name)
} else {
require.Error(t, err, tc.name)
}
}
}
func TestValidateGenesis(t *testing.T) {
testCases := []struct {
name string
genState GenesisState
expPass bool
}{
{
name: "default",
genState: DefaultGenesisState(),
expPass: true,
},
{
name: "valid genesis",
genState: GenesisState{
Accounts: []GenesisAccount{
{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{1, 2, 3},
Storage: []GenesisStorage{
{Key: ethcmn.BytesToHash([]byte{1, 2, 3})},
},
},
},
},
expPass: true,
},
{
name: "invalid genesis",
genState: GenesisState{
Accounts: []GenesisAccount{
{
Address: ethcmn.Address{},
},
},
},
expPass: false,
},
{
name: "duplicated genesis account",
genState: GenesisState{
Accounts: []GenesisAccount{
{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{1, 2, 3},
Storage: []GenesisStorage{
NewGenesisStorage(ethcmn.BytesToHash([]byte{1, 2, 3}), ethcmn.BytesToHash([]byte{1, 2, 3})),
},
},
{
Address: ethcmn.BytesToAddress([]byte{1, 2, 3, 4, 5}),
Balance: big.NewInt(1),
Code: []byte{1, 2, 3},
Storage: []GenesisStorage{
NewGenesisStorage(ethcmn.BytesToHash([]byte{1, 2, 3}), ethcmn.BytesToHash([]byte{1, 2, 3})),
},
},
},
},
expPass: false,
},
}
for _, tc := range testCases {
tc := tc
err := tc.genState.Validate()
if tc.expPass {
require.NoError(t, err, tc.name)
} else {
require.Error(t, err, tc.name)
}
}
}
